MS Dhoni IPL 2026 Return Delayed After Injury Setback

MS Dhoni will not be rushing back onto the field for Chennai Super Kings. CSK head coach Stephen Fleming confirmed on Sunday that Dhoni’s return from a calf injury has been delayed after the problem got worse during a warm-up game before the IPL 2026 season began.

CSK lost to the Gujarat Titans by eight wickets at the MA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ai that day, their fifth defeat in eight matches. But the talk after the game quickly moved to Dhoni, who has now missed every single one of CSK’s games this season.

What Happened to Dhoni Before IPL 2026 Started

Dhoni has been with the CSK squad since March. Videos and photos of him training at the nets and taking part in practice sessions have been circulating on social media throughout this period. Despite that visible presence, he has not appeared in any of CSK’s eight league matches. He has not even been at the ground on match days.

The original plan was to keep him out for only the first two weeks of the competition. That timeline has since fallen apart.

CSK captain Ruturaj Gaikwad had explained the situation in a club video posted four days before Fleming’s press conference. According to Gaikwad, the injury happened during a practice match before the season. “That’s when he snapped his calf, and then he wasn’t able to run as comfortably as he wanted to,” Gaikwad said.

Gaikwad also noted that Dhoni had used the time on the sidelines to watch the younger players in match simulations. He felt confident about what he saw from them, which gave Dhoni room to focus on getting fit rather than rushing back. “Slowly, slowly, he is getting there. Never know, maybe next game, maybe after that, but definitely one day for sure,” Gaikwad said.

Fleming on Dhoni’s Recovery Progress

Fleming was direct about what happened. “The calf is a tough one. If he takes off and rips the calf again, then he will be gone for the whole season. So we pushed it early. In a warm-up game, he tweaked it again, as far as I understand. And since then, he has been just working hard to get some movement into it. But there was a setback.”

Fleming made clear that Dhoni himself is driving the decisions around his own fitness. The CSK camp is not setting deadlines or applying pressure.

“He’s the guide on this one. And he’s working hard with the physio and doing all the rehab. We’re just waiting for the word, really. But all I can keep saying is it’s not making light of this, he is progressing and doing everything,” Fleming said.

Dhoni is 44 years old and has a long history of playing through physical discomfort in the IPL. But this injury is taking longer than the franchise anticipated, and with the risk of a complete season-ending tear if he comes back too early, a cautious approach makes sense.

CSK’s Situation With Six Games Remaining

CSK sit sixth in the IPL 2026 points table after eight games, having won three and lost five. Six league matches remain. Their next fixture is at home against the Mumbai Indians on May 2.

The pressure is growing. CSK needs wins to stay in playoff contention, and while the squad has managed without Dhoni so far, his return would considerably change the dynamic in the dugout and the dressing room. Whether that happens in time to matter this season remains uncertain.
